Grand Cayman Marriott Beach Resort

On the sands of Cayman Island’s Seven Mile Beach

Surrounded by beach

Centrally located on Grand Cayman's famed Seven Mile beach, this oceanfront Marriott Beach Resort is within walking distance of restaurants, shops, and night clubs; George Town is 2 miles away.

See this hotel on a map

Smoke-free resort

This smoke-free resort provides a snorkeling reef 50 yards off the beach, an oceanfront pool with adjacent spa tub, a watersports center that arranges rentals and excursions, a full-service spa, and a kids' club.

More hotel information

Private balconies

Spacious rooms at Grand Cayman Marriott Beach Resort offer private balconies and ocean, courtyard, or island views. Extras include pillowtop mattresses, 300-thread-count linens, and compact refrigerators.

I want to live in this hotel on Seven Mile Beach!

This was our first visit to the Caymans and it was great. The Marriott is on a wonderful stretch of the Seven Mile Beach and they have made the beach so accessible. The chairs are all set out on the beach and there are plenty of umbrellas so everyone can find a spot and be comfortable. The pool is right on the beach although most people took advantage of the beach. And the beach is powder, not sand. And the rooms are great, as well as the service. One thing - the Caymans are expensive in general, and the food and drinks at the hotel are no exception. Bring plenty of money!

Downtown Georgetown is now mainly a Cruise ship haven, populated mostly with very expensive jewelry stores. I would not take children to the "fun" downtown restaurants like Senor Frogs or Margaritaville, since they get wild when the Cruise ship is in port. In other towns those are nighttime party places, but the Cruise ships only stop during the day and that’s their biggest business. The Turtle farm is the greatest place for adults and kids. They’ve done a great job of laying it out and they let you hold the turtles and you can take plenty of pictures. We did not go to the Stingray place but I understand it’s very crowded and it scares the younger children.
